The Comedy Store is historic and classic for live stand-up comedy. It's been around since the 80s and has gotten huge names coming through. They have tons of comics who are up and coming, and those that have huge careers in the industry. No matter what show you're seeing, it's guaranteed to be funny.
The venue has three separate rooms doing different shows each night. They each differ in size, ticket price, and comedians. The smaller room is The Belly Room and features up and coming comics in LA. Don't be mistaken though, you'll still laugh your socks off. They do have a two-drink minimum, so keep that in mind. The Belly Room was small and cozy and no-frills. Some tips - If you're not vaccinated against COVID, you can't come. They ask for proof of vaccination at the door, and no photos are allowed inside.
